Halloween is a time for fun and treats, but it’s essential to protect your smile while enjoying the festivities. Follow these Halloween dental tips to keep your teeth healthy and happy:
Choose Tooth-Friendly Treats
Instead of indulging in sticky, sugary candies that can cling to your teeth and cause cavities, opt for tooth-friendly treats like sugar-free gum, dark chocolate, or snacks made with nuts and seeds.
Practice Moderation
If you do indulge in sweets, enjoy them in moderation and avoid overindulging. Rinse your mouth with water after eating treats to help wash away sugar and acid that can harm your teeth.
Stay Hydrated
Drink plenty of water throughout the day, especially if you’re consuming sugary snacks. Water helps rinse away food particles and bacteria and keeps your mouth hydrated to prevent dry mouth and bad breath.
Maintain Your Oral Hygiene Routine
Don’t forget to brush your teeth twice a day for two minutes each time and floss once daily, even on Halloween. Cleaning your teeth and gums regularly helps prevent cavities and gum disease.
Consider Healthy Alternatives
Instead of handing out traditional candy to trick-or-treaters, consider offering healthier alternatives like mini bags of pretzels, trail mix, or sugar-free snacks.
